Selena Quintanilla was born in 1971 in Lake Jackson, Texas, and she was performing Tejano music with her Mexican-American family around the state at a very young age. By her teens she was on the rise to stardom, and soon her music was hitting the charts. Selena y Los Dinos (English: Selena and the Guys) was an American Tejano band formed in 1981 by Tejano singer Selena and her father Abraham Quintanilla. The band remained together until the murder of Selena in 1995, which caused the dissolution of the band in the same year. On Wednesday, Pérez ...The Quintanilla family launched the official Selena Radio in 2014, as part of Q-Productions, which plays non-stop Selena music and commentaries by her family. It’s available 24/7 at www ...The Quintanilla family, a struggling middle-class family from Lake Jackson, Texas, started their music career as Selena y Los Dinos, performing at weddings and using peach cans as stage lights. Their gigs were a dependent factor in their income, as the family had to stay in a relative’s home in Corpus Christi, Texas, due to losing their home.Many small businesses sought financial relief during the pandemic but a new LendingTree survey finds very few looked to family and friends for help. Quintanilla sued Perez and two companies planning to turn the book into a series.The band became the family's main source of income after they were evicted from their home during the Texas oil bust of 1982. They filed for bankruptcy after Abraham's Mexican restaurant suffered as a result of the oil bust. The Quintanilla family moved to Corpus Christi, Texas, and Selena y Los Dinos began recording music professionally.Selena’s father, Abraham Quintanilla, was interviewed by TMZ about the documentary — which he called “nothing but lies” — and added that the family was not involved, according to the ...Selena’s father, Abraham Quintanilla Jr., also shared his earlier memories of Saldívar in the “Behind the Music” special. “At one time, my whole family liked Yolanda,” he said. “We ...07.14.23 at 11:56 am. In the wings,” Suzette (Noemí González) says. “On the bus to tell you to move your butt, we’re gonna ...The ten unreleased songs were recorded 37 years ago by a 13 to 16-year-old Selena.To learn more about this story: https://www.billboard.com/music/latin/selen...An hour before the doors opened, rumors that the casket was empty began circulating, which prompted the Quintanilla family to have an open-casket viewing. About 30,000 to 40,000 fans passed by Selena’s casket and more than 78,000 signed a book of condolence. The video and flash photography was banned at the request of Selena’s family.That same year, a movie about her life—Selena—was released and starred newcomer Jennifer Lopez in the leading role.
